fork download
  1. #include<iostream>
  2. #include<string>
  3. int main()
  4. {
  5.  
  6. int d,i,j,k,l,n,m;
  7. char a[1000000];
  8. std::cin>>n;
  9. for(m=0;m<n;m++)
  10. {
  11. std::cin>>a;
  12. l=0;
  13. for(i=0;a[i]!='\0';i++)
  14. {
  15. if(a[i]=='<')
  16. {
  17. k=i;
  18. for(j=i;a[j]!='\0';j++)
  19. {
  20. if(a[++j]=='>')
  21. { l++;
  22. i--;
  23. for(;a[j]!='\0';j++)
  24. {
  25.  
  26. a[j]=a[j+1];
  27. }
  28.  
  29. }
  30. }
  31.  
  32. for(;a[k]!='\0';k++)
  33. {
  34. a[k]=a[k+1];
  35. }
  36. }
  37. }
  38. std::cout<<2*l<<"\n";
  39. }}
  40.  
Success #stdin #stdout 0s 4196KB
stdin
5
<><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><><>
<>
<<>
<><>
<<>>
stdout
270
2
0
4
4